Clear--Clears all entries except /
TIME OF DAY. Once cooking has
begun, however, CLEAR will
function only after STOP has
been touched.

Memory/Recall--For Multi-Stage
cooking, MEMORY/RECALL is
used in setting:
• Cooking time
• Power level
• Temperature
Also, it is used to recall each mem-
ory stage in a multi-stage cooking
program.
Lp Control--Used in setting
the desired food temperature.
"Temperature Controlled" cook-
ing can be done only when the
temperature probe is plugged into
the socket inside the oven.
